Your most frequently asked questions about textured velvet leggings

  • Brushed velvet leggings (also called textured or crushed velvet) are distinguished by their smooth, slightly irregular surface that subtly catches the light. They are lighter, more flexible, and contain more elastane, giving them an ultra-soft feel and great freedom of movement.

    The corduroy leggings feature raised vertical ribs. Denser and more structured, they offer firmer support with their integrated high-waisted elastic and a more polished look.

    In summary:

    • Brushed velvet = soft, light, luminous, versatile
    • Corduroy = structured, dense, graphic, sophisticated

  • Caring for brushed velvet is simple if you follow these tips:

    • Washing : Machine wash at 30°C maximum, delicate cycle
    • Always inside out : To protect the velvet surface
    • With similar colors : Avoid mixing with white or very light colors
    • No tumble drying : Air dry flat or on a hanger
    • No fabric softener : Velvet remains naturally soft, and fabric softener damages the fibers of the garments.
    • Ironing if necessary : ​​At a low temperature (110°C max) and always on the reverse side

    Our Italian velvet is designed to retain its softness and luster even after numerous washes. The quality of the fiber makes all the difference!

Our velvet expertise

For several years, I have been designing velvet leggings by working directly with the fabric: its reaction to movement, its shape memory, and its stability over time. The velvet I use is an Italian technical velvet, chosen for its controlled elasticity, density, and durability, even after repeated wear.

Each style is tested on a mannequin to achieve a high waist that provides support without constricting, a smooth front, and a fluid silhouette. Manufacturing takes place in France, in a workshop specializing in stretch fabrics, guaranteeing the precision of assembly essential to velvet.

This demanding fabric requires real expertise: pile direction, texture, light, behavior under tension. These parameters completely influence the final result.

It is this work of adjustment — from the choice of velvet to movement testing — that transforms a simple velvet legging into a comfortable, durable and flattering piece.
